The Sun Exchange’s vision is enable Africa to leapfrog into a new clean energy future using a blockchain enabled crowdfunding platform. Their solution enables anyone, anywhere in the world, to buy and lease solar assets to power villages starting in South Africa.
In this episode, I talk to Abraham Cambridge, CEO and Founder of The Sun Exchange. Abe explains how they are bypassing the disinterest of governments and banks in solar energy, while combining the best decentralised technology and financing model to create game changing impact.
Abe talks about how solar energy is the most distributed and democratic source of energy and why the openness and transparency is key to making their platform work. Abe also shared on how a change in market conditions and his experience running a solar installation cooperative in Cornwall, UK lead to the founding of The Sun Exchange.
